Former 2022 Profesional Fighters League (PFL) champion Ante Delija crushed former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C) and PFL fighter Yorgan De Castro in under a minute at FNC 22: Fabjan vs. Kita, held at Arena Stozice in Ljubljana, Slovenia, this past weekend (Sat., April 12, 2025)
The two Heavyweights were supposed to collide back at PFL 2 in April 2023, but an injury forced Delija to withdraw.
De Castro started the fight, guns blazing, charging straight at Delija, throwing bombs. To his credit, he landed a few flush punches on Delija, but nothing fazed the Croatian. After weathering the storm for 30 seconds, the tide turned as Delija started answering back and hit De Castro with a nasty combo that eventually made “The Mad Titan” cover-up. The referee stopped the bout moments later.

After a year away from action, Delija (25-6) returned to the win column with his quick stoppage. Before his victory over De Castro, “Walking Trouble” suffered a first-round knockout loss to Valentin Moldavsky (watch highlights).in the 2024 PFL season, which snapped his five-fight win streak.
Now likely done with PFL, Delija could target a UFC comeback. He was once set to face Ciryl Gane in 2020, but PFL halted the fight due to his contract.
Since joining FNC, De Castro (12-7) has suffered two first-round knockout losses. He did, however, shine in his Bare Knuckle Fighting Championship (BKFC) debut earlier this year, earning a doctor-stoppage win againstBobby Brents (watch here).
After Saturday’s defeat, De Castro shared on social media, “Not sure what’s next or when is next for now I am hitting the pause button!!”
